首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

创建在特定时间开始运行的pubsub函数

是一种在云计算中常见的技术。Pubsub函数是一种事件驱动的计算模型,它可以在特定的时间触发执行,通常用于处理实时数据流或异步任务。

Pubsub函数的优势在于可以实现高度可扩展的计算能力,同时提供了灵活的事件触发机制。通过将函数与特定的时间触发器关联,可以实现定时执行任务、定期数据处理、定时报表生成等功能。

应用场景方面,创建在特定时间开始运行的pubsub函数可以用于各种定时任务,例如定时备份数据、定时生成报表、定时发送通知等。此外,它还可以用于实时数据流处理,例如实时数据分析、实时监控等。

对于腾讯云的相关产品和产品介绍链接地址,可以推荐使用腾讯云的云函数(Cloud Function)服务。云函数是腾讯云提供的一种无服务器计算服务,可以实现按需执行代码的功能。通过云函数,可以方便地创建和管理pubsub函数,并与腾讯云的其他服务进行集成。

腾讯云云函数的产品介绍链接地址:https://cloud.tencent.com/product/scf

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何在Linux中特定时间运行命令

我只是想知道在Linux 操作系统中是否有简单方法可以在特定时间运行一个命令,并且一旦超时就自动杀死它 —— 因此有了这篇文章。请继续阅读。...在 Linux 中在特定时间运行命令 我们可以用两种方法做到这一点。 方法 1 – 使用 timeout 命令 最常用方法是使用 timeout 命令。...但是,如果你使用 timeout 命令运行它,它将在给定时间间隔后自动终止。如果该命令在超时后仍在运行,则可以发送 kill 信号,如下所示。...$ man timeout 有时,某个特定程序可能需要很长时间才能完成并最终冻结你系统。在这种情况下,你可以使用此技巧在特定时间后自动结束该进程。...安装 timelimit 后,运行下面的命令执行一段特定时间,例如 10 秒钟: $ timelimit -t10 tail -f /var/log/pacman.log 如果不带任何参数运行 timelimit

4.8K20
  • Web组件库 PubSubJS 消息发布订阅

    PubSubJS应该能够在可以执行JavaScript任何地方运行。浏览器、服务器、电子书阅读器、旧手机、游戏机。...基本示例 //创建一个订阅主题函数 var mySubscriber = (msg,data)=>{console.log(msg,data)} // 将该功能添加到特定主题订阅者列表中 // 我们保留了返回令牌...取消特定订阅 //创建一个函数来接收主题 var mySubscriber = (msg,data)=>{console.log(msg,data)} //将该函数添加到特定主题订阅者列表中 //...我们保留了返回令牌,以便能够取消订阅 // 从后面的主题开始 var token = PubSub.subscribe('MY TOPIC', mySubscriber); //取消订阅此订阅者此主题...开发者工具中堆栈跟踪即时例外 从1.3.2版本开始,您可以强制立即异常(而不是延迟异常),这好处是在开发工具中查看时保持堆栈跟踪。

    39300

    Vue之全局事件总线和消息订阅与发布

    我们将其定义在 main.js 文件中,创建在 vm 实例对象身上,因为 vm 实例对象只有一个 创建全局事件总线有两种方法: 1、 const Demo = Vue.extend({}) const...,方法在 methods 里面定义 //在全局事件总线 bus中绑定一个hello事件,后面的回调是箭头函数,用于接收数据this.bus 中绑定一个 hello 事件,后面的回调是箭头函数,用于接收数据...this.bus中绑定一个hello事件,后面的回调是箭头函数,用于接收数据this.bus....控制台,输入 npm i pubsub-js,进行安装 在传数据和接收数据组件中都要通过 import pubsub from 'pubsub-js' 引入这个文件 然后就可以开始使用了 接收数据...('我接收到数据了',data); }) 复制代码 这里有一个注意点,那就是回调函数第一个参数 msgName,代表是 hello,即订阅消息名,这个必须要写,因为默认第一个参数就是消息名,第二个参数才是数据

    78140

    React消息订阅与发布pubsub

    订阅者(Subscriber):订阅并接收消息组件或实体。PubSub模式工作原理如下:发布者发布消息:发布者发送一个特定消息,可以携带附加数据。...订阅者订阅消息:订阅者注册对特定消息监听,并指定接收消息后处理函数。发布者发送消息:发布者将消息发送给所有订阅了该消息订阅者。订阅者接收消息:订阅者接收到消息后,执行事先注册处理函数。...发布者发布消息:在需要发布消息组件中,通过调用publish方法发布特定消息。您可以选择携带附加数据。...订阅者订阅消息:在需要订阅消息组件中,通过调用subscribe方法注册对特定消息监听,并指定接收消息后处理函数。发布者发送消息:发布者发送消息时,所有订阅了该消息订阅者将接收到消息。...订阅者处理消息:订阅者接收到消息后,将执行其注册处理函数。现在,让我们通过一个示例来演示在React中使用pubsub-js实现PubSub模式过程。

    1.1K20

    测试小姐姐问我 gRPC 怎么用,我直接把这篇文章甩给了她

    在多个平台阅读量都了新高,在 oschina 更是获得了首页推荐,阅读量到了 1w+,这已经是我单篇阅读高峰了。 看来只要用心写还是有收获。...其中 docker 项目中提供了一个 pubsub 极简实现,下面是基于 pubsub 包实现本地发布订阅代码: package main import ( "fmt" "strings"...Subscribe 方法接收全部消息,而 SubscribeTopic 根据特定 Topic 接收消息。...一般 WEB 服务 API,或者是 Nginx 都会设置一个超时时间,超过这个时间,如果还没有数据返回,服务端可能直接返回一个超时错误,或者客户端也可能结束这个连接。...如果没有这个超时时间,那是相当危险。所有请求都阻塞在服务端,会消耗大量资源,比如内存。如果资源耗尽的话,甚至可能会导致整个服务崩溃。 那么,在 gRPC 中怎么设置超时时间呢?

    1.1K00

    云端迁移 - Evernote 基于Google 云平台架构设计和技术转型(上)

    由于旧数据中心位于加州北部,而新产品构建在GCP上,因此要尽可能减少网络延迟。...当进入云环境时,使用物理负载均衡器并不可取,因此我们开始研究虚拟负载均衡解决方案。...Google网络负载平衡器将成为客户流量入口点,并将流量均衡到我们HAProxy服务器站点,这样就能够将客户流量路由到其特定分片。...同时使用可靠可扩展排队机制PubSub,NoteStores现在通过在PubSub队列中生成job来通知Reco服务器要完成工作。...每个Reco服务器通过简单地订阅特定PubSub队列并确认他们何时完成资源上识别作业方式处理新添加到队列上内容。

    2.5K110

    一文入门react全家桶

    3.作用:复用编码, 简化项目编码, 提高运行效率 1.4.3.模块化 当应用js都以模块来编写, 这个应用就是一个模块化应用 1.4.4.组件化 当应用是以多组件方式实现, 这个应用就是一个组件化应用...编码操作 1.内部读取某个属性值 this.props.name 2.对props中属性值进行类型限制和必要性限制 第一种方式(React v15.5 开始已弃用): Person.propTypes...2.React组件中包含一系列勾子函数(生命周期回调函数), 会在特定时刻调用。 3.我们在定义组件时,会在特定生命周期回调函数中,做特定工作。 2.6.3....3.2 交互(从绑定事件监听开始) 3.2....消息订阅-发布机制 1.工具库: PubSubJS 2.下载: npm install pubsub-js --save 3.使用: 1)import PubSub from 'pubsub-js' /

    3.4K20

    弃用 Lambda,Twitter 启用 Kafka 和数据流新架构

    然而,随着数据快速增长,高规模仍然给工程师们用来运行管道数据基础设施带来了挑战。比如,我们有一个交互和参与管道,能够以批处理和实时方式处理高规模数据。...旧架构 旧架构如下图所示。我们 Lambda 架构具有批处理和实时处理管道,构建在 Summingbird 平台内,并与 TSAR 集成。...旧 Lambda 架构 目前,我们在三个不同数据中心都拥有实时管道和查询服务。为了降低批处理计算开销,我们在一个数据中心运行批处理管道,然后把数据复制到其他两个数据中心。...通常当这种情况发生时,需要很长时间才能使拓扑滞后下降。...第一步,我们创建了一个单独数据流管道,将重复数据删除前原始事件直接从 Pubsub 导出到 BigQuery。然后,我们创建了用于连续时间查询计数预定查询。

    1.7K20

    Redis发布订阅和事务实现原理

    //保存所有频道订阅关系 dict *pubsub_channels; //... } pubsub_channels属性数据类型是字典类型,该字典中key保存了频道名,value...//保存所有频道订阅关系 dict *pubsub_channels; //保存所有模式订阅关系 list *pubsub_patterns; //... } typedef...ZREM,DEL等,在执行后都会调用touchWatchKey函数对watched_keys字典进行检查,如果字典中存在该key,那么会将监视该key对应客户端REDIS_DIRTY_CAS标记打开...□ 当服务器在RDB持久化模式下运作时,服务器只会在特定保存条件被满足时,才会执行BGSAVE 命令,对数据库进行保存操作,并且异步执行BGSAVE 不能保证事务数据被第一时间保存到硬盘里面,因此RDB...□ 当服务器运行在AOF持久化模式下,并且appendfsync选项值为always 时,程序总会在执行命令之后调用同步(sync)函数,将命令数据真正地保存到硬盘里面,因此这种配置下事务是具有耐久性

    59620

    Knative 入门系列4:Eventing 介绍

    与其操心我们应用程序或函数监听上述事件逻辑,不如当那些被关注事件发生时,让 Knative 去处理并通知我们。 如果要自己实现这些功能则需要做很多工作并要编写实现特定功能代码。...举几个例子: GCP PubSub (谷歌云发布订阅) 订阅 Google PubSub 服务中主题并监听消息。...我们将部署一个运行在 8080 端口上用于监听 POST 请求并输出请求结果函数,如例 4-1 所示。...该实例将以一个特定配置运行,在这个演示案例中则是一个预定义服务帐户。可以看到我们配置如示例 4-4 所示。...KubernetesEventSource,简称为 k8sevents,并传递一些特定实例配置,例如我们应该运行 Namespace (命名空间)和使用 Service Account (服务帐户

    3.3K10

    React脚手架

    创建项目并启动第一步,全局安装:npm i -g create-react-app第二步,切换到想项目的目录,使用命令:create-react-app project_name第三步,进入项目文件夹...:通过props传递,要求父提前给子传递一个函数注意defaultChecked 和 checked区别,类似的还有:defaultValue 和 value状态在哪里,操作状态方法就在哪里react...: true, //控制服务器接收到请求头中host字段值 /* changeOrigin设置为true时,服务器收到请求头中host为:localhost:5000...工具库: PubSubJS下载: npm install pubsub-js --save使用:1)import PubSub from ‘pubsub-js’ //引入2)PubSub.publish...(‘delete’, data) //发布消息3)this.token=PubSub.subscribe(‘delete’, function(_, data){ }); //订阅4)PubSub.unsubscribe

    42220

    JS设计模式 - 笔记

    设计模式概略 + 常用设计模式 包括单例模式、策略模式、代理模式、发布订阅模式、命令模式、组合模式、装饰器模式、适配器模式 # 设计模式概略 ---- # 什么是设计模式 定义:在软件设计过程中,针对特定问题简洁而优雅解决方案...(); ob.subscribe("add", (val) => console.log(val)); ob.publish("add", 1); # 命令模式 定义:执行某些特定事情指令 应用场景...,在程序运行期间给对象动态地添加职责。...应用场景:数据上报、统计函数执行时间 示例: 使用前 const ajax = (type, url, param) => { console.log(param); } const getToken...应用场景:接口不兼容情况 示例: 使用前 const aMap = { show: () => { console.log('开始渲染地图A'); } }; const

    85130

    Go 每日一库之 watermill

    下面看示例运行: ? 路由 上面的发布和订阅实现是非常底层模式。在实际应用中,我们通常想要监控、重试、统计等一些功能。...路由其实管理多个订阅者,每个订阅者在一个独立goroutine中运行,彼此互不干扰。订阅者收到消息后,交由注册时指定处理函数(HandlerFunc)。...中间件 watermill中内置了几个比较常用中间件: IgnoreErrors:可以忽略指定错误; Throttle:限流,限制单位时间内处理消息数量; Poison:将处理失败消息以另一个主题发布...; Retry:重试,处理失败可以重试; Timeout:超时,如果消息处理时间超过给定时间,直接失败。...~ Correlation:处理函数生成消息都统一设置成原始消息中correlation id,方便追踪消息来源; Recoverer:捕获处理函数panic,包装成错误返回。

    1.1K20
    领券